Replacement windows can boost the value of your home

Many homeowners are looking to improve their homes to boost the resale value. Window replacement is an excellent method to achieve this. Its benefits include improved aesthetics, increased natural light, and improved energy efficiency. Additionally, it is typically less expensive than other renovation projects.

While it's not easy to predict the exact amount of return you can expect from your investment, many studies have shown that there is a positive relationship between window replacement and the value of homes. In fact, it's one of the highest returns on investments of all home improvement projects according to Remodeling Magazine's Cost vs. Value Report 2022.

The exact return you get from your investment will be contingent on a number of factors such as the type and amount of windows you install as well as the quality of the materials used, and the climate in your area. Windows in your home are crucial to your comfort. They let in natural light and keep your house cool or warm, based on the conditions. If your windows are outdated and old it is recommended to replace them to increase the comfort of your home. New replacement windows will increase the value of your home's resales and make it more energy-efficient.

If properly maintained, windows of high quality can last up to 20 years. However, they'll eventually show signs of aging, such as framing that has warped or broken glass. These indicators are a sign that it's time to replace your windows. Older windows lose their insulation which could result in more expensive energy bills. Additionally, windows let moisture into your home, which can cause wood decay.

If you're considering replacing your windows Look for windows that have the best energy efficiency ratings. They will help prevent heat loss in the winter and help reduce the cost of energy by keeping your home cooler in summer. You can also choose windows with a low-U-factor in order to stop heat from escape. Certain windows are equipped with gas injected into the panes of windows in order to increase their insulation properties.
